Tripura's Ashmita Dey wins India's first Commonwealth judo gold
Agartala, Aug. 1 -- After gymnast Dipa Karmakar, chess champion Arshiya Das and tennis player Somdev Devvarman, Tripura has another sporting icon to celebrate. Ashmita Dey, 23, from South Snaichari, a small village in Tripura's South district, became India's first-ever Commonwealth Games judo gold medallist on Friday.
Her father, a bicycle mechanic, always supported her ambitions despite the family's financial struggles.
Ashmita is the youngest of three siblings. Her elder sister is married, while her elder brother, Debabrata Dey, works for a private company in Santirbazar.
She completed her initial schooling in Sonaichari.
